Metztli Napkin Rings

The Metztli Napkin Rings elevate the dining ritual by merging the raw, porous texture of volcanic stone with the golden radiance of polished brass interiors. Each ring reflects the lunar cycle — the stone as the shadowed surface of the moon, and the brass as its luminous glow. Designed to transform a simple table setting into a ceremonial act, these napkin rings are sculptural details that bring both grounding weight and radiant warmth to the dining experience.

  • Materials: Volcanic stone (outer ring) + polished brass (inner lining)
  • Dimensions: Ø 4.5–5 cm, width ~2.5 cm
  • Weight: ~150–200 g each
  • Finish: Contrasting — porous volcanic exterior with smooth golden brass interior
  • Craftsmanship: Hand-carved and hand-finished; each ring carries unique stone porosity
  • Use: Functional napkin holders for dining, also collectible sculptural accents
